LGV Category C1 (3.5 – 7.5 tonnes)
Start your professional driving journey with a Category C1 licence, suitable for drivers aged 18 and over. This licence allows you to operate light goods vehicles weighing between 3.5 and 7.5 tonnes – ideal for local delivery work, removals, and specialist transport roles.
Although LGV licences are commonly staged as C1, C, and C+E, you are not required to complete a Category C1 licence before moving on to the larger Category C. In fact, many trainees choose to go directly to Category C for broader job opportunities and increased earning potential.
However, a Category C1 licence is often a specific requirement for certain professions, such as paramedic students who need it to drive frontline ambulances. If you’re entering this career path, the C1 licence is essential.
